Rafael Benitez: 'Napoli still in title race'

Benitez: 'Napoli still in title race'

Rafael Benitez has rubbished suggestions that his Napoli side are already too far off the pace to win the Serie A this season.

Benitez's side looked on course to move within six points of leaders Juventus when Jose Callejon struck in stoppage time to give them a 2-1 lead away to Inter Milan last night.

However, Hernanes pounced with a header moments later to save Inter but, despite being eight points adrift, the Spaniard claims that a Scudetto is not yet beyond Napoli.

"We've already shown a year ago that we are able to fight at the top," Benitez, who led the Naples club to a third-placed finish last season, told Sky Sport Italia.

"I'm not disappointed with the draw but content with the reaction of the team at a difficult ground like this one [San Siro].

"I'm unhappy because we went ahead twice and twice we conceded right away but, overall, the second half pleased me."

The Partenopei lie seventh in the standings.
